Wales, Scotland and Northern Ireland: how the standards differ

Wales requires solar on new homes three weeks before England does, and got there by a different route. Scotland does not require it at all. Northern Ireland proposed something and has not enacted it. Four administrations, four positions — and most coverage describes only England’s.

Four administrations, four different positions.

  • Wales — requires it, from 4 March 2027, under new requirement L2A. Three weeks ahead of England.
  • England — requires it, from 24 March 2027, under requirement L3, sized against a notional array.
  • Scotlandno mandatory requirement we could find. Photovoltaics appear as an option for voluntary sustainability levels and inside one compliance calculation.
  • Northern Irelandno requirement. A 2023 discussion document proposed one; we found no adopted outcome.

Building standards are devolved. “New homes must have solar” is true in two nations out of four, on two different dates, by two different routes.

Wales: the same idea, drafted separately

The Building etc. (Amendment) (Wales) Regulations 2026 were made on 3 March 2026. Most of the instrument came into force on 1 July 2026; the renewable generation provisions — regulations 3, 8(1), 8(2) and 8(4) — come into force on 4 March 2027.

The new requirement reads:

L2A.—(1) When a dwelling or a building containing a dwelling is erected, a system for renewable electricity generation must be installed on-site.

(2) The system installed under sub-paragraph (1) must be — (a) designed to enable any electricity generated by it to be available for the use of residents of the buildings, and (b) capable of generating a reasonable output taking into account the design of the buildings and its surroundings.

Anyone who has read England’s L3 will recognise the structure immediately: install a system, make the electricity available to residents, achieve a reasonable output. The exemptions match too — a “relevant building” within regulation 7(4), and a building where a reasonable output is not possible given design or surroundings.

One visible difference in the drafting

England’s L3 requires the system to be installed “on the building or within the boundaries of the curtilage of the building”. Wales’s L2A says simply “installed on-site”.

We are not going to tell you what that difference does in practice — that is a question for the Welsh guidance and for building control, and we have not been able to read the guidance. But it is a real difference in the words, and it is the kind of thing a designer working across both nations needs to notice rather than assume away.

England also carries a third exemption Wales’s does not appear to: equivalent output supplied from a system outside the curtilage. Read both instruments if you are working on either side of the border.

What we do not have is the Welsh sizing method — the equivalent of England’s notional array. It will be in the Welsh Approved Document L (2026), published in April 2026, and gov.wales blocked our access to it. See the note at the foot of this page; we would rather have a hole than a guess.

Scotland: not a requirement, and easy to misread as one

Scotland’s building standards are set under the Building (Scotland) Regulations 2004, with statutory guidance in the Building standards technical handbook: domestic — section 6 on energy and section 7 on sustainability. The current edition was published on 9 March 2026 and applies to warrants submitted on or after 6 April 2026.

Two places photovoltaics appear, and neither is a requirement:

In the sustainability levels. Mandatory standard 7.1 requires a statement of sustainability, with levels from Bronze upwards. The optional Bronze Active and Silver Active levels require a low or zero carbon generating technology — but photovoltaics are one of several qualifying technologies, alongside wind, heat pumps, solar thermal, combined heat and power, fuel cells, biomass and biogas. The mandatory Bronze level does not require any of them.

Inside one compliance calculation. The notional dwelling used to set the target emissions rate under standard 6.1 includes photovoltaics for the fossil-fuel-heated compliance package, at a capacity of 0.01 kWp per square metre of total floor area, capped by roof area. That figure is an order of magnitude smaller than England’s 0.22 kWp/m² — but the comparison is misleading, because the two do completely different jobs. Scotland’s is an assumption inside a model for one heating route. England’s defines a target you must meet.

The direction of travel in Scotland is a general fabric and energy standard — the “Scottish equivalent to the Passivhaus standard” — rather than a solar mandate, with implementation discussed for 2028. Scotland’s New Build Heat Standard, which is sometimes described as a Future Homes Standard equivalent, is a heating measure: it prohibits direct-emission heating systems in new buildings. It has nothing to say about generating electricity.

Northern Ireland: proposed, not adopted

The edition in force is Technical Booklet F1, June 2022 — published 25 March 2022 and effective from 30 June 2022. On renewable electricity it encourages rather than requires:

Where renewable generation technologies are used to produce electricity, designers are encouraged to engage at an early stage with Northern Ireland Electricity Networks (NIE) to confirm that an export connection can be provided.

A Department of Finance discussion document of 2023 proposed, as one option in a phased uplift, a photovoltaic requirement sized at 40% of roof plan area divided by 6.5 — worked in the document as 3.2 kWp for a 104 m² two-storey house — with an alternative option of low-carbon heating instead of PV.

Note how close that is to England’s rule, and how different: 40% of the roof plan area, not of the ground floor area, and a divisor rather than a panel-efficiency multiplier.

We found no adopted outcome, no consultation response, and no new edition of Technical Booklet F1. As far as we can establish, nothing has been enacted.

If you are building, buying or designing across borders

Check which nation’s rules apply, not which nation’s coverage you read. An England Approved Document has no force in Wrexham or Kirkcaldy.

In Wales, the date is 4 March 2027, and the instrument is WSI 2026/60. Get the Welsh Approved Document L (2026) for the sizing method — and if you do, we would be glad of a copy.

In Scotland, do not assume a solar requirement exists. If a developer tells you the house has solar “because of the regulations”, the regulations are not why.

In Northern Ireland, treat any claim that a requirement is coming as a proposal until a new Technical Booklet F1 says otherwise.
